Generally, the harvested agricultural products are sorted according to their sizes and weights and their grades are sorted. In the past, sorting operations for sorting the sizes of agricultural products were performed manually or by a mechanized sorting device ought. Here, the term agricultural product refers to a broad sense including all kinds of ordinary fruits, vegetables and root crops. Herein, the term "whole grain" of agricultural products will be described as an example.

Examples of garlic separators used in rural areas include Korean Patent No. 10-0662537, Korean Patent No. 10-0546818, Korean Registered Utility No. 20-0391184, and Korean Patent No. 10-1365158.

However, even if the garlic is automatically selected by the machine through the garlic separator, the system for shipment after sorting is manually performed.

Referring to FIGS. 1 through 3,

The garlic G selected through the garlic separator falls through the distribution portion A of the sorter S and is loaded in a box placed under the inside of the divider so that when the box B is filled, Lift up the box with both hands and put it back in place. The garlic, which is sorted and sized according to the size, is put into the bag 7 by using the storage body shown in FIG.

Moreover, the packaging material finally packed with weight is generally used in the sense that it includes a bag (a bag, a negative bag) in the form of a synthetic resin-woven fabric. In particular, In the case of the shellfish or the fishery products of agricultural products which are large in size and do not cause a particular problem due to external exposure, as shown in FIG. 2, the bag 10 having the mesh- .

However, in the above system, ① the garlic selected in the sorter is put in a box and moved to a certain place and then loaded, ② after put in a bag, ③ measured on the balance, and then transferred to the warehouse ④ By carrying out by hand, it requires a lot of labor, the worker is easily fatigued, the work efficiency is low, and when slipping on the operator's hand during transportation, the contents of the box or sack are damaged, Foot injuries occasionally occurred.

The present invention has been conceived to solve the above problems, and it is an object of the present invention to provide a bag carrier for agricultural products in which the selected garlic can be weighed while being loaded on a bag, It is possible to carry out bagging and weight measurement directly at the sorting place, thereby improving the time efficiency and work efficiency from shipment to shipment warehouse, So that it is possible to prevent the worker from being injured by removing the labor of lifting the bag.

According to an aspect of the present invention, there is provided a bag carrier for agricultural products, comprising: an upper frame coupled to an inlet of a package to which an agricultural product is loaded; A plurality of support frames, one side of which is connected to the upper frame to support the upper frame; And a lower frame connected to the other side of the support frame to support a package on which the produce is loaded, wherein a plurality of wheels are coupled to a bottom of the lower frame, and a weight measuring means is coupled to the upper portion of the lower frame The upper frame is composed of an opening portion having one side opened and a closing portion closing the other side, and the supporting frame connected to the opening portion of the upper frame is lower in height than the remaining supporting frames.

In addition, the upper frame and the lower frame are each in a rectangular shape, and the upper frame is smaller in surface area than the lower frame.

In addition, the weight measuring means may be a scale, and the lower frame may have a step to prevent the scale from being separated from the scale.

The bag carrier for agricultural products according to the present invention includes an upper frame 100 to which an opening of a package 600 in which the input agricultural products are stacked is coupled, A plurality of support frames 200 one side of which is connected to the upper frame to support the frame, and a lower frame 300 connected to the other side of the support frame and supporting the package on which the produce is loaded.

5 and 6, the upper frame 100 includes an opening 110 through which a conventional metal round bar is opened as an inlet into which agricultural products are input, a connection portion 110 connecting the side portion 121 and the side portion, And a closure part 120 which is made up of a closure part 122 and closes the other side, thereby having a "C" shape as a whole.

The opening portion 110 is configured to provide convenience when attaching or removing an upper portion of a package body 600 (hereinafter, referred to as a bag as a temporary example of a package body) to be performed by an operator, The operator inserts the upper end of the bag 600 into the side portion 121 and the connecting portion 122 through the opening portion 110 and then extends from the connecting portion 122 to the side portion 121 The upper part of the bag is attached to the upper frame 100 while maintaining tension.

The bag is detached from the side portion 121 and the connecting portion 122 while lifting the upper portion of the bag through the opening portion, as opposed to the above-mentioned attaching.

Here, the reason why the bag may be attached to the upper frame is that the material of the bags 10 and 11 is formed of a synthetic resin (PP series), and therefore the surface of the bag 10 is smooth and durable. The peripheral length of the upper frame is formed to be slightly smaller than the circumferential length of the bag so that the bag is inserted into the upper frame as if the bag is held in a tight fit so that the bag is slightly elongated due to the material properties of the bag and is attached to the upper frame by its tension .

Normally, a commercially available bag is formed in a circular shape and has a diameter of 20 cm and a circumference of 62.8 cm. Therefore, when the circumference of the upper frame is formed to be about 60 cm, the tolerance of 2.8 cm is controlled by the elongation of the bag, And is attached to the upper frame with a tension according to the elongation.

In addition, it is preferable that the open part 110 of the upper frame be placed on the distributor side of the sorter, because the garlic falling through the distributor is not vertically dropped but is inclined at the inclination of the distributor So that the load is eccentrically applied to one side of the bag attached to the upper frame by the tension at the time of striking, whereby the bag is removed from the upper frame So that it is possible to reduce the phenomenon that the bag is removed from the upper frame by increasing the grounding area of the bag and the upper frame on the side where the garlic is struck as much as possible.

In addition, the length of the support frame 200 to be formed is different in consideration of the inclination direction of the selector distributing unit, that is, the open support frame 210, which is placed on the distributor side, is formed to be short and the closed support frame It is preferable that the upper frame 220 is formed to be long so that the upper frame can be inclined toward the distribution portion. This is because garbage can be collected in a stable manner by increasing the grounding area of garlic falling along the inclination direction of the distribution portion as described above.

In this embodiment, the rectangular bag-shaped agricultural product carrier is described as an embodiment, but the shape of the carrier may be any shape as long as the bag can be detachably attached thereto.

However, the reason why the rectangular bag-shaped agricultural product bag carrier is used as an example is that the bag is easy to attach and detach, especially the shape of the bag is changed through the angle, so that the attachment force by tension is much higher than the circular shape to be.

The support frame 200 is connected to the corners of the upper frame so as to support the upper frame by a conventional metal round bar, but the length of the support frame 200 is usually set considering the length of the bag.

To this end, the support frame is composed of an opening part support frame 210 and a closing part support frame 220 respectively provided at the corners of the opening part 110 and the closing part 120, And the like.

In addition, the opening portion support frame 210 may be integrally formed with the upper frame, and only the closing portion support frame 220 may be attached to the edge of the closing portion 120 by welding or the like, The upper frame and the opening portion are integrally formed by forming a "C" -shaped metal round bar and bending the upper end of the round bar by 90 ° so as to form an "a" shape when viewed from the side, By attaching the support frame 220 to the edge of the closing portion 120 by welding or the like. This is a manufacturing process that is greatly simplified compared to the other manufacturing processes, thereby reducing the production cost.

The lower frame 300 supports the garlic and the weight measuring means 400 (hereinafter referred to as an example of the weighing means) and is formed into a regular square plate shape, The support frame is attached by a method such as welding.

Here, the lower frame is not necessarily in the form of a plate if the balance 400 can be seated, but may be in the form of a frame.

Further, it is preferable that the lower frame is formed with a step 310 to prevent the balance from coming off, and the step is formed to be lower than the height of the balance along the circumference of the hub frame. As a result, it is possible to secure an area capable of gripping the balance at the time of detachment and attachment of the balance, thereby facilitating detachment and attachment for replacement and repair of the balance.

In addition, it is also possible that the bottom frame supports the bottom of the "A" section to support the balance and the side section to function as a step by welding four ordinary "A "

In addition, a plurality of wheels are coupled to the bottom of the lower frame. When the garlic dropped by the sorter is loaded in a predetermined amount (normally, 20 kg of the whole garlic is in units of one kilogram) through the scale, It is possible to dispense with the manual process of moving the garlic loaded in the box to the surveying place and moving it to the scale at the surveying place and wrapping it in the bag after the measurement, .

As described above, in order to carry out the above-described conventional procedure for every box and bag, the operator repeatedly performs the operation of lifting the bag from several hundred to several thousand times. Especially, in case of bag filled with garlic after measurement, It is very difficult for the worker to lift the sack so that the waist should be bent as much as possible. Therefore, after a long period of work, In many cases. Also, there was a high risk of various safety accidents such as a back injury due to excessive force on the waist, a slack slip from the hand holding the sack, and injured the foot.

However, not only the manual process from the above-mentioned sorting machine to the measurement but also the process of transferring from the sorter to the shipping depot after the measurement is also easily carried through the wheel with the bag attached to the carrier according to the present invention, It is only necessary to lay it down on the conveyor belt of the shipping warehouse so that the process of lifting the bag from the sorting machine to the shipping warehouse can be omitted.

Here, the surface area of the lower frame is formed larger than the surface area of the upper frame so that the entire shape forms a pyramid shape, that is, a structure in which the lower frame is typically sold, And above all, the garlic placed on the balance is stably measured and the center of gravity of the bag carrying the garlic is moved downward to thereby stably stand the carrier.

Hereinafter, the entire process of using the transfer material according to the present invention will be described.

The operator inserts the bags into the plurality of carrier openings, places the respective conveying members on the respective distributing portions of the sorter, and operates the sorter. When the sorter is operated, the garlic sorted by size is fed to each conveyer It is loaded.

Then, the worker confirms the weight of the garlic loaded on the size-specific conveying body through the balance, and when the amount reaches a predetermined amount, the conveying body is taken out and the new conveying body is placed in the distribution portion. Subsequently, the conveyor with the garlic-filled bag is pushed by the worker to the shipping warehouse, the garlic-filled bag is placed on the conveyor belt of the shipping warehouse, the new bag is inserted into the empty conveying body, and the bag is next to the sorter.

Through the repetition of this process, the worker can easily work by skipping the process of bending the back and lifting the heavy garlic.
